Default DC.COM: Moving to 4-3 Scheme Might Improve Special Teams Units

Nick Eatman
DallasCowboys.com Staff Writer

IRVING, Texas – The decision to change defensive schemes from a 3-4 to a 4-3 is an obvious attempt to bolster a defensive unit that ranked 19th last season.

But it might help in more ways than one.

If switching to the 4-3 scheme can actually have a positive influence on the special teams units, then it’ll be an added bonus for the Cowboys, who have two new coordinators this year. Monte Kiffin replaces Rob Ryan as defensive coordinator and will run his Tampa 2 scheme. Rich Bisaccia will run the special teams, replacing Joe DeCamillis, who left for the Bears.
